Johnny Depp And Amber Heard To Divorce After 15 Months Of Marriage

The actress cited "irreconcilable differences" for ending the 15-month marriage.

Actress Amber Heard has filed for divorce from Johnny Depp after 15 months of marriage, citing irreconcilable differences.

Heard's filing on Monday followed the May 20 death of Depp’s mother, according to TMZ. People magazine confirmed the divorce petition.

Depp, 52, met Heard, 30, on the set of the 2011 film, "The Rum Diary." They married in February 2015.

The divorce filing follows months of speculation about a spilt. Heard acknowledged the challenges of her marriage to Marie Claire in December.

"I try not to react to the horrible misrepresentation of our lives, but it is strange, and hard,” she said.

Representatives for the couple did not immediately reply to requests for comment.

Last month, Depp and Heard appeared in an awkward video publicly apologizing for bringing dogs into Australia illegally.

This would be Depp’s second divorce. A marriage to Lori Anne Allison ended in 1985.

Prior to meeting Heard, Depp had a 14-year relationship with actress Vanessa Paradis. They have two children together. Depp also had a relationship with model Kate Moss for several years.

The divorce filing comes just days before the release of Depp’s latest film, "Alice Through the Looking Glass," in which he plays the Mad Hatter.
